I had by error 2 Personal Microsoft 365 accounts - I stopped one (the hotmail) but I discovered that the one I kept (the gmail) doesn't contain the content of my One Note. How can I copy the full content of my one note to mu gmail account ?

    OneNote content is stored in Microsoft accounts/OneDrive, not in Gmail itself. The content can be moved from the old Hotmail-based Microsoft account into the Microsoft account that uses the Gmail address by copying notebooks/sections between accounts.

    On macOS, use OneNote to move the content:

    1. Ensure both Microsoft accounts are available
      • Sign in to OneNote on Mac with the old Hotmail-based Microsoft account (where the notes currently are) and with the Microsoft account that uses the Gmail address.
    2. Create or open a notebook under the Gmail-based account
      • Using the Gmail-based Microsoft account, create a new notebook where the copied content will be stored, if one does not already exist.
    3. Copy sections from the old account to the new account (recommended method)
      • In OneNote on Mac, open the notebook that belongs to the old Hotmail account.
      • Click the Notebook drop-down (top left) and select that notebook.
      • Hold Shift and click to select all sections that need to be moved.
      • Drag and drop the selected sections into the notebook that is stored in the Gmail-based account’s OneDrive.
      • Alternatively, right-click a section and choose Copy Section To..., then choose a notebook under the Gmail-based account.
    4. Verify everything is synced
      • Wait for OneNote to finish syncing the destination notebook in the Gmail-based account.
      • Sign in to OneNote (desktop, web, or mobile) with the Gmail-based Microsoft account and confirm that all sections/pages appear there.

    If the old Hotmail-based Microsoft account is already closed and cannot be signed into, the content can only be recovered if there is a backup or exported copy (for example, from OneNote backups or OneDrive copies). If backups exist on Mac:

    1. In OneNote on Mac, go to OneNote > Preferences > Backups.
    2. Select Back Up All Notebooks Now (if still possible) or File > Open Backups to open existing backups.
    3. Open the backed-up notebook/sections, then multi-select sections and drag them into a notebook stored under the Gmail-based Microsoft account’s OneDrive.

    Once copied, the full OneNote content will reside under the Microsoft 365 account that uses the Gmail address. Gmail itself will not store OneNote pages; they remain in OneDrive associated with that Gmail-based Microsoft account.
